Small overlap front
The small overlap front evaluation consists of a driver-side and a passenger-side component. If the results of the two evaluations differ, then the combined small overlap rating is equal to the lower rating.

Tested vehicle: 2021 Volvo XC40 Recharge EV 4-door 4wd
Rating applies to 2025 models
The Volvo XC40 Recharge, a new electric SUV, was introduced in the 2021 model year and the Volvo C40 Recharge was introduced in the 2022 model year. Beginning with 2025 models, the XC40 Recharge became known as the EX40 and the C40 Recharge became known as the EC40.

Technical measurements for this test
Measures of occupant compartment intrusion on driver side
| Evaluation criteria | Measurement |
|---|---|
| Test ID | CEN2103 |
| Lower occupant compartment | |
| Lower hinge pillar max (cm) | 5 |
| Footrest (cm) | 3 |
| Left toepan (cm) | 2 |
| Brake pedal (cm) | 1 |
| Parking brake (cm) | |
| Rocker panel lateral average (cm) | 2 |
| Upper occupant compartment | |
| Steering column | 0 |
| Upper hinge pillar max (cm) | 4 |
| Upper dash (cm) | 4 |
| Lower instrument panel (cm) | 3 |

Child seat anchors
Rating applies to 2025 models
| Evaluation criteria | Rating |
|---|---|
| Overall evaluation | |
| Vehicle trim | T5 Momentum |
| Seat type | leather |
This vehicle has 2 rear seating positions with complete child seat attachment (LATCH) hardware. It has 1 additional seating position with a tether anchor only.
